3. Installation
1. Plug the modules into the appropriate power supply
cabinet (or hook up the /SA-2 models to corresponding
power supplies) and connect suitable video and optical
fiber equipment using appropriate cabling.
CLEAN THE OPTICAL FIBER CONNECTORS
PRIOR TO INSERTION INTO THE OPTICAL PORT.
Equipment and cabling should be installed and earthed
such that protection is provided against lightning and
similar influences.
2. Upon powering up, the green DC LEDs and SYNC
LED (on the RX) should glow green, indicating link
integrity. If the RX SYNC LED shines red, there is no
link synchronization. If SYNC problems occur after
powering up, please first check the received optical
power arriving at the RX unit using an optical power
meter.
3. With the optical link in good order, connecting a video
signal should make the corresponding channel's TX and
RX NV (no video) LEDs go out.
An RX NV LED still lit would indicate that no
decodable video signal is arriving through the associated
channel.
4. Care and maintenance
For reliable operation of OCTA 40x0 modules, please
observe the following precautions:
- Prevent dust from collecting on the equipment
- Protect the equipment against moisture
- Maintain sufficient free space around the equipment for
cooling.
